FS#28517 - libpng 1.5.8-2 make cairo cannot work correctly on some png

DetailsDescription:
Some png will simply get width 0 and height 0 Steps to reproduce: run this code (compile gcc `pkg-config --cflags cairo` `pkg-config --libs cairo` http://paste.kde.org/425162/ Against this png: http://wstaw.org/m/2012/02/19/input.png It should output: 103 52 But with 0 and 0. |
